BLT is better- it's built into the couch. AKL was the old time springs, it's terrible. We pulled the mattress off and put it on the floor. Daughters who have grown up sleeping on the couch have voted AKL as the worst. They can't wait for all of DVC to have murphy beds.
 
I am sorry to say they are both the same and terrible! When you get to your room call housekeeping and ask for a pillow top mattress for the sleeper sofa. They will even put it on for you.
